What Is a Google Core Update?

A core update is a major revision to Google’s algorithm that affects how websites are ranked. These updates aim to improve content quality, relevancy, authority, and user experience across search results.

Key Changes in the May 2025 Core Update

  • Topical Authority: Google rewarded sites that publish in a consistent niche.
  • Freshness: Updated and accurate content ranked higher.
  • Author Expertise: Google placed more value on author identity and experience.
  • AI Content Scrutiny: Low-quality or purely automated content was downgraded.
  • Spam Detection: Tactics like keyword stuffing and cloaked redirects were penalized.

Who Was Affected?

Sites that were hit hardest include:

  • Affiliate-heavy blogs with thin content
  • AI-only content farms
  • Aggregator websites without unique value
  • Sites with no author bios or trust indicators

How to Recover from the May 2025 Update

  1. Audit Your Website: Use tools like Ahrefs, SEMrush, and Google Search Console to identify problems.
  2. Improve Content Depth: Use Frase or SurferSEO to optimize content based on user intent.
  3. Optimize Site Architecture: Use internal linking and content silos to enhance topic clustering.
  4. Show Trust: Add author bylines, organization details, testimonials, and contact pages.
  5. Remove Weak Pages: Prune or merge outdated, irrelevant, or underperforming content.

How Long Does Recovery Take?

Recovery varies, but many sites report progress within 4–8 weeks when they apply quality improvements. Google states full recovery might not be seen until the next core update.
